引言
在当今的开源软件世界中,README.md 文件是每个项目不可或缺的部分。它不仅是开发者与用户沟通的重要桥梁,还直接影响到项目的可读性和吸引力。本文将详细介绍如何创建一个高效、易于阅读的README.md模板,以及一些最佳实践。
什么是README.md文件?
README.md 文件是一个使用Markdown格式编写的文档,通常位于项目的根目录中。它为访问者提供了项目的基本信息和使用指南。
为什么README.md文件重要?
README.md 文件的重要性不言而喻,主要体现在以下几个方面:
- 提供项目概述:帮助用户快速了解项目的功能和目标。
- 提升项目的可用性:为用户提供使用说明和操作指南。
- 增强专业形象:一个结构清晰的文档能够提高项目的专业性和可信度。
README.md模板结构
一个优秀的README.md文件通常包含以下几个部分:
1. 项目名称
首先,应该明确项目的名称,并附上一个简短的描述。
markdown
项目的简要介绍。
2. 项目描述
在这里详细描述项目的功能、目标用户以及实现的方法。
markdown
项目描述
该项目旨在…
3. 特性
列出项目的主要特性,方便用户快速了解。
markdown
特性
- 特性一
- 特性二
- 特性三
4. 安装步骤
提供清晰的安装说明,使用户能够快速上手。
markdown
安装
-
克隆项目: bash git clone https://github.com/用户名/项目名.git
-
运行安装命令: bash npm install
5. 使用说明
详细的使用说明和示例,帮助用户理解如何使用该项目。
markdown
使用
在终端中输入以下命令: bash 命令示例
6. 贡献指南
鼓励用户参与贡献,并列出贡献的步骤和规则。
markdown
贡献
- Fork 此项目
- 创建您的特性分支
- 提交您的更改
- 打开一个Pull Request
7. 许可证
说明项目的开源许可证类型。
markdown
许可证
此项目采用MIT许可证。
最佳实践
在撰写README.md文件时,可以遵循以下最佳实践:
- 简洁明了:避免使用复杂的术语,保持简单。
- 使用图像和图表:适当插入图像或示例,以增强可读性。
- 更新及时:确保文档中的信息与项目实际情况保持一致。
FAQ
1. README.md文件应该包含哪些内容?
一个完整的README.md文件通常应包括项目名称、描述、特性、安装步骤、使用说明、贡献指南和许可证等部分。
2. 如何使用Markdown格式?
Markdown是一种轻量级标记语言,您可以使用简单的符号来格式化文本,例如使用#
表示标题、-
表示无序列表等。
3. README.md的文件名有什么要求?
README.md是GitHub的默认文件名,不需要进行修改。其他格式的README文件,如README.txt,可能不被自动识别。
4. 如何提升README.md的可读性?
通过使用清晰的标题、列表和示例,可以显著提升README.md的可读性。同时,使用适当的Markdown格式来组织内容也至关重要。
结语
通过使用上述模板和最佳实践,您可以创建出一个专业、高效的README.md文件,使您的项目在GitHub上更具吸引力。记住,一个优秀的README.md是项目成功的第一步。